Population

How many people, and the typical age.

Lamington has 2,036 people, which is larger than about 80% of similar areas. The typical resident is 33, making the area noticeably younger than both Western Australia and Australia.

Age profile

How the population splits across age groups.

Children under 15 make up 23.2% of the population, which is well above the national figure of 18.2%. This helps explain why the area is so young, while seniors aged 65 and over are much less common here than elsewhere, at only 7.8%.

Identity & relationships

First Nations identity and marital status.

De facto relationships are much more common here than in most areas, at 18.7%. About 4% of residents identify as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ander, which is slightly higher than the state and national figures.
